import { expect } from 'chai'; import getScrollbarSize from '@mui/utils/getScrollbarSize'; import { ModalManager } from './ModalManager'; interface Modal { mount: Element; modalRef: Element; } function getDummyModal(): Modal { return { mount: document.createElement('div'), modalRef: document.createElement('div'), }; } describe('ModalManager', () => { let modalManager: ModalManager; let container1: HTMLDivElement; beforeAll(() => { modalManager = new ModalManager(); container1 = document.createElement('div'); container1.style.paddingRight = '20px'; Object.defineProperty(container1, 'scrollHeight', { value: 100, writable: false, }); Object.defineProperty(container1, 'clientHeight', { value: 90, writable: false, }); document.body.appendChild(container1); }); afterAll(() => { document.body.removeChild(container1); }); it('should add a modal only once', () => { const modal = getDummyModal(); const modalManager2 = new ModalManager(); const idx = modalManager2.add(modal, container1); modalManager2.mount(modal, {}); expect(modalManager2.add(modal, container1)).to.equal(idx); modalManager2.remove(modal); }); describe('managing modals', () => { let modal1: Modal; let modal2: Modal; let modal3: Modal; beforeAll(() => { modal1 = getDummyModal(); modal2 = getDummyModal(); modal3 = getDummyModal(); }); it('should add modal1', () => { const idx = modalManager.add(modal1, container1); modalManager.mount(modal1, {}); expect(idx).to.equal(0); expect(modalManager.isTopModal(modal1)).to.equal(true); }); it('should add modal2', () => { const idx = modalManager.add(modal2, container1); expect(idx).to.equal(1); expect(modalManager.isTopModal(modal2)).to.equal(true); }); it('should add modal3', () => { const idx = modalManager.add(modal3, container1); expect(idx).to.equal(2); expect(modalManager.isTopModal(modal3)).to.equal(true); }); it('should remove modal2', () => { const idx = modalManager.remove(modal2); expect(idx).to.equal(1); }); it('should add modal2 2', () => { const idx = modalManager.add(modal2, container1); modalManager.mount(modal2, {}); expect(idx).to.equal(2); expect(modalManager.isTopModal(modal2)).to.equal(true); expect(modalManager.isTopModal(modal3)).to.equal(false); }); it('should remove modal3', () => { const idx = modalManager.remove(modal3); expect(idx).to.equal(1); }); it('should remove modal2 2', () => { const idx = modalManager.remove(modal2); expect(idx).to.equal(1); expect(modalManager.isTopModal(modal1)).to.equal(true); }); it('should remove modal1', () => { const idx = modalManager.remove(modal1); expect(idx).to.equal(0); }); it('should not do anything', () => { const idx = modalManager.remove(getDummyModal()); expect(idx).to.equal(-1); }); }); describe('overflow', () => { let fixedNode: HTMLDivElement; beforeEach(() => { container1.style.paddingRight = '20px'; fixedNode = document.createElement('div'); fixedNode.classList.add('mui-fixed'); document.body.appendChild(fixedNode); window.innerWidth += 1; // simulate a scrollbar }); afterEach(() => { document.body.removeChild(fixedNode); window.innerWidth -= 1; }); it('should handle the scroll', () => { fixedNode.style.paddingRight = '14.4px'; const modal = getDummyModal(); modalManager.add(modal, container1); modalManager.mount(modal, {}); expect(container1.style.overflow).to.equal('hidden'); expect(container1.style.paddingRight).to.equal(`${20 + getScrollbarSize(window)}px`); expect(fixedNode.style.paddingRight).to.equal(`${14.4 + getScrollbarSize(window)}px`); modalManager.remove(modal); expect(container1.style.overflow).to.equal(''); expect(container1.style.paddingRight).to.equal('20px'); expect(fixedNode.style.paddingRight).to.equal('14.4px'); }); it('should disable the scroll even when not overflowing', () => { // simulate non-overflowing container const container2 = document.createElement('div'); Object.defineProperty(container2, 'scrollHeight', { value: 100, writable: false, }); Object.defineProperty(container2, 'clientHeight', { value: 100, writable: false, }); document.body.appendChild(container2); const modal = getDummyModal(); modalManager.add(modal, container2); modalManager.mount(modal, {}); expect(container2.style.overflow).to.equal('hidden'); modalManager.remove(modal); expect(container2.style.overflow).to.equal(''); document.body.removeChild(container2); }); it('should restore styles correctly if none existed before', () => { const modal = getDummyModal(); modalManager.add(modal, container1); modalManager.mount(modal, {}); expect(container1.style.overflow).to.equal('hidden'); expect(container1.style.paddingRight).to.equal(`${20 + getScrollbarSize(window)}px`); expect(fixedNode.style.paddingRight).to.equal(`${getScrollbarSize(window)}px`); modalManager.remove(modal); expect(container1.style.overflow).to.equal(''); expect(container1.style.paddingRight).to.equal('20px'); expect(fixedNode.style.paddingRight).to.equal(''); }); describe('shadow dom', () => { let shadowContainer: HTMLDivElement; let container2: HTMLDivElement; beforeEach(() => { shadowContainer = document.createElement('div'); const shadowRoot = shadowContainer.attachShadow({ mode: 'open' }); container2 = document.createElement('div'); shadowRoot.appendChild(container2); }); afterEach(() => { document.body.removeChild(shadowContainer); }); it('should lock body scrolling and compensate for its scrollbar when the container is in a shadow root', () => { const modal = getDummyModal(); const initialBodyPaddingRight = document.body.style.paddingRight; container2.style.overflow = 'scroll'; document.body.style.paddingRight = '20px'; document.body.appendChild(shadowContainer); modalManager.add(modal, container2); modalManager.mount(modal, {}); expect(container2.style.overflow).to.equal('scroll'); expect(container2.style.paddingRight).to.equal(''); expect(document.body.style.overflow).to.equal('hidden'); expect(document.body.style.paddingRight).to.equal(`${20 + getScrollbarSize(window)}px`); modalManager.remove(modal); expect(container2.style.overflow).to.equal('scroll'); expect(document.body.style.overflow).to.equal(''); expect(document.body.style.paddingRight).to.equal('20px'); document.body.style.paddingRight = initialBodyPaddingRight; }); }); describe('restore styles', () => { let container2: HTMLDivElement; beforeEach(() => { container2 = document.createElement('div'); }); afterEach(() => { document.body.removeChild(container2); }); it('should restore styles correctly if overflow existed before', () => { const modal = getDummyModal(); container2.style.overflow = 'scroll'; Object.defineProperty(container2, 'scrollHeight', { value: 100, writable: false, }); Object.defineProperty(container2, 'clientHeight', { value: 90, writable: false, }); document.body.appendChild(container2); modalManager.add(modal, container2); modalManager.mount(modal, {}); expect(container2.style.overflow).to.equal('hidden'); modalManager.remove(modal); expect(container2.style.overflow).to.equal('scroll'); expect(fixedNode.style.paddingRight).to.equal(''); }); it('should restore styles correctly if overflow-x existed before', () => { const modal = getDummyModal(); container2.style.overflowX = 'hidden'; Object.defineProperty(container2, 'scrollHeight', { value: 100, writable: false, }); Object.defineProperty(container2, 'clientHeight', { value: 90, writable: false, }); document.body.appendChild(container2); modalManager.add(modal, container2); modalManager.mount(modal, {}); expect(container2.style.overflow).to.equal('hidden'); modalManager.remove(modal); expect(container2.style.overflow).to.equal(''); expect(container2.style.overflowX).to.equal('hidden'); }); }); }); describe('multi container', () => { let container3: HTMLDivElement; let container4: HTMLDivElement; beforeEach(() => { container3 = document.createElement('div'); document.body.appendChild(container3); container3.appendChild(document.createElement('div')); container4 = document.createElement('div'); document.body.appendChild(container4); container4.appendChild(document.createElement('div')); }); it('should work will multiple containers', () => { modalManager = new ModalManager(); const modal1 = getDummyModal(); const modal2 = getDummyModal(); modalManager.add(modal1, container3); modalManager.mount(modal1, {}); expect(container3.children[0]).toBeInaccessible(); modalManager.add(modal2, container4); modalManager.mount(modal2, {}); expect(container4.children[0]).toBeInaccessible(); modalManager.remove(modal2); expect(container4.children[0]).not.toBeInaccessible(); modalManager.remove(modal1); expect(container3.children[0]).not.toBeInaccessible(); }); afterEach(() => { document.body.removeChild(container3); document.body.removeChild(container4); }); }); describe('container aria-hidden', () => { let modalRef1; let container2: HTMLDivElement; beforeEach(() => { container2 = document.createElement('div'); document.body.appendChild(container2); modalRef1 = document.createElement('div'); container2.appendChild(modalRef1); modalManager = new ModalManager(); }); afterEach(() => { document.body.removeChild(container2); }); it('should not contain aria-hidden on modal', () => { const modal2 = document.createElement('div'); modal2.setAttribute('aria-hidden', 'true'); expect(modal2).toBeInaccessible(); modalManager.add({ ...getDummyModal(), modalRef: modal2 }, container2); expect(modal2).not.toBeInaccessible(); }); it('should add aria-hidden to container siblings', () => { const secondSibling = document.createElement('input'); container2.appendChild(secondSibling); modalManager.add(getDummyModal(), container2); expect(container2.children[0]).toBeInaccessible(); expect(container2.children[1]).toBeInaccessible(); }); it('should not add aria-hidden to forbidden container siblings', () => { [ 'template', 'script', 'style', 'link', 'map', 'meta', 'noscript', 'picture', 'col', 'colgroup', 'param', 'slot', 'source', 'track', ].forEach(function createBlacklistSiblings(name) { const sibling = document.createElement(name); container2.appendChild(sibling); }); const inputHiddenSibling = document.createElement('input'); inputHiddenSibling.setAttribute('type', 'hidden'); container2.appendChild(inputHiddenSibling); const numberOfChildren = 16; expect(container2.children.length).equal(numberOfChildren); modalManager.add(getDummyModal(), container2); expect(container2.children[0]).toBeInaccessible(); for (let i = 1; i < numberOfChildren; i += 1) { expect(container2.children[i].getAttribute('aria-hidden')).to.equal(null); } }); it('should add aria-hidden to previous modals', () => { const modal2 = document.createElement('div'); const modal3 = document.createElement('div'); container2.appendChild(modal2); container2.appendChild(modal3); modalManager.add({ ...getDummyModal(), modalRef: modal2 }, container2); // Simulate the main React DOM true. expect(container2.children[0]).toBeInaccessible(); expect(container2.children[1]).not.toBeInaccessible(); modalManager.add({ ...getDummyModal(), modalRef: modal3 }, container2); expect(container2.children[0]).toBeInaccessible(); expect(container2.children[1]).toBeInaccessible(); expect(container2.children[2]).not.toBeInaccessible(); }); it('should remove aria-hidden on siblings', () => { const modal = { ...getDummyModal(), modalRef: container2.children[0] }; modalManager.add(modal, container2); modalManager.mount(modal, {}); expect(container2.children[0]).not.toBeInaccessible(); modalManager.remove(modal); expect(container2.children[0]).toBeInaccessible(); }); it('should keep previous aria-hidden siblings hidden', () => { const modal = { ...getDummyModal(), modalRef: container2.children[0] }; const sibling1 = document.createElement('div'); const sibling2 = document.createElement('div'); sibling1.setAttribute('aria-hidden', 'true'); container2.appendChild(sibling1); container2.appendChild(sibling2); modalManager.add(modal, container2); modalManager.mount(modal, {}); expect(container2.children[0]).not.toBeInaccessible(); modalManager.remove(modal); expect(container2.children[0]).toBeInaccessible(); expect(container2.children[1]).toBeInaccessible(); expect(container2.children[2]).not.toBeInaccessible(); }); }); });
